The Ins and Outs of the R08 Return Code

Categories: ACH Payments

Are you often left perplexed by ACH payment rejections and errors in your NACHA files? An essential part of the puzzle you may be missing is understanding ACH Return Codes – specifically, the R08 Code.

Quick Rundown of the R08 ACH Return Code:
– Represents a scenario where a payment has been halted.
– Used when a transaction fails due to an issue encountered by the originating depository financial institution (ODFI).
– Signals the termination of funds being delivered to the account of the intended receiver.
– Employed when the ODFI is unable to process a transaction for several reasons such as account closure, insufficient funds, or suspicious activities.

As leaders in the field, here at NachaTech, we are eager to help guide you through the complexities of the notorious R08 ACH Return Code in Automated Clearing House transactions. It’s a key piece in navigating your way to successful financial transactions as well as the prevention of payment rejections.

Here’s a short guide on understanding the R08 Return Code, its vital role, and how to handle this specific ACH Return Code when it crops up. By the end of this, you’ll be well prepared to tackle such hiccups like a pro.

Infographic on R08 Return Code - r08 return code infographic cause_effect_text

From the importance of acknowledging the specifics of the distinct return codes to the reasons these errors surface, this article presents a comprehensive guide on everything you need to know about handling the R08 Return Code. Let’s begin our journey towards error-free financial transactions.

Understanding the R08 Return Code

Definition of the R08 Return Code

The R08 return code represents a specific scenario in the Automated Clearing House (ACH) network where a payment has been stopped. This code is employed when an Originating Depository Financial Institution (ODFI) encounters an issue that prevents the completion of an ACH transaction.

The Role of the R08 Return Code in ACH Transactions

The R08 return code acts as a standard communication tool within the ACH network. It allows the ODFI to provide a standardized message to the Receiving Depository Financial Institution (RDFI), explaining why the payment could not be processed. The code may be used in various situations, such as when the account being debited has been closed, there are insufficient funds in the account, or the RDFI suspects fraudulent activity.

The Difference Between R08 and Other Common ACH Return Codes

While the R08 return code signifies a payment stop, understand it’s just one of many return codes used within the ACH network. Each code serves a specific purpose and provides valuable information to both the ODFI and RDFI, helping them understand why a payment could not be processed as intended.

For instance, in the labyrinth of ACH file formats, transaction codes and service class codes guide the process of successful financial transactions. Transaction codes, consisting of two digits, provide crucial information about the type of account involved, the type of transaction, and the destination of the transaction. On the other hand, service class codes determine the type of entries included in a batch, organizing and categorizing transactions within an ACH file.

In the grand scheme of things, the R08 return code, along with other return codes, acts as the DNA of an ACH file, providing it with a unique identity and functionality.

From understanding the definition and role of the R08 return code to knowing the difference between the R08 and other common ACH return codes, it’s clear that this code plays a pivotal role in the ACH network. As we delve deeper into the subject, we’ll explore the reasons for R08 return code errors and how we at NachaTech can help resolve these issues effectively.

Reasons for the R08 Return Code

The R08 return code is a common stumbling block for financial institutions dealing with Automated Clearing House (ACH) transactions. It signifies that a transaction has been halted, and usually points to an issue with the account details, insufficient funds, or suspicious activity. Let’s break down these reasons in more detail.

Incorrect Account Details

One of the primary causes for the R08 return code is incorrect bank account information. Transaction details such as the account number or routing number, if entered wrongly, can cause the ACH network to reject the payment. This could be due to simple typos or outdated account information.

This issue underscores the need for meticulous data handling and verification when processing ACH transactions – a principle we at NachaTech strongly uphold in our solutions.

Insufficient Funds in the Account

Just like a traditional check, an ACH payment can bounce if there are insufficient funds in the account. If a business tries to debit a customer’s account and the funds are not available, the transaction will be rejected, triggering the R08 return code. This is a common scenario, especially in situations where customers may not be aware of their current balance.

Suspicious Activity or Fraudulent Transactions

Banks and financial institutions are constantly on the lookout for suspicious activities and potential fraud. If they detect any irregular activity, they might freeze the account in question. This safety measure can lead to halted payments and subsequently, the R08 return code.

This holds true even when the account holder is unaware of the fraudulent transactions. Until the issue is resolved, all payments linked to that account will be stopped, underlining the importance of robust security measures in financial operations.

Other Common Reasons for R08 Return Code

There are several other reasons why an R08 return code might be issued. These include ‘stale dates’ on payments, incorrectly filled out forms, missing schedules or forms in tax returns, math errors in tax filings, and incorrect or missing Social Security Numbers (SSNs).

Understanding these common triggers can help financial institutions anticipate and prevent R08 errors in ACH transactions. At NachaTech, we are committed to helping our clients navigate these challenges and ensure smooth, error-free financial operations.

How to Resolve the R08 Return Code

When an ACH transaction gets flagged with an R08 return code, it can disrupt your financial operations and impact your bottom line. But don’t worry; there are a few ways to effectively resolve this issue and restore normal operations.

Contacting the Customer for Clarification

The very first step in resolving an R08 return code is to contact the customer for clarification. It’s possible that the customer made a mistake when entering their bank account or routing number. In some cases, they may have accidentally selected an old or incorrect address, resulting in the order being shipped to the wrong location. By contacting the customer, you can identify the issue and take steps to correct it.

Verifying Bank Routing and Account Numbers

Next, you need to verify the bank routing and account numbers. An R08 return code can occur if these numbers are incorrect or if they don’t match the bank’s records. You can request the customer to provide a copy of a voided check to verify this information. It’s crucial to double-check these details before reprocessing the transaction to prevent the same error from reoccurring.

Re-entering the Transaction with Proper Authorization

Once you have verified the bank routing and account numbers, you can re-enter the transaction with proper authorization. This means ensuring all the customer’s information is accurate and up-to-date before processing the transaction again. Be sure to double-check all the necessary documents and confirm that all amounts match across every document.

Requesting a Cash Advance for Insufficient Funds

In some cases, the funds may be available in the customer’s account but have not been processed due to insufficient funds. When this happens, you could request a cash advance from the customer’s bank to cover any fees or charges associated with clearing the check.

By following these steps, you can successfully resolve an R08 return code and restore smooth operations. However, preventing these issues from occurring in the first place is even more beneficial. At NachaTech, we provide tools and solutions to help you manage your ACH transactions efficiently and reduce the likelihood of running into return codes.

In the next section, we will explore how to prevent R08 returns and how NachaTech can assist in this process.

Preventing R08 Returns

Preventing R08 returns is crucial to maximizing your organization’s efficiency and maintaining customer satisfaction. At NachaTech, we understand the challenges that come with this return code and have identified several strategies to mitigate them.

Establishing Clear Return Policies

Establishing clear and comprehensive return policies is the first step towards preventing R08 returns. Such policies should outline the conditions under which a product can be returned, the return process, and any associated fees. Clear communication of these policies to customers before they make a purchase can help prevent misunderstandings that might lead to R08 returns.

Providing Detailed Information to Customers Before Purchase

Providing customers with detailed information about their purchases can also prevent R08 returns. This can be achieved by providing accurate product descriptions, including measurements, material details, and color options. Customers should also be able to view high-quality images of the product from different angles. Clear and comprehensive product information can help customers make informed buying decisions and reduce the likelihood of returns due to ordering errors.

Investing in Tracking Technology

At NachaTech, we recommend investing in tracking technology to monitor your products in transit. This will allow you to keep customers informed about their order status and address any delivery issues promptly, reducing the chances of R08 returns. Moreover, tracking technology can also help you identify patterns in returns and take appropriate preventive measures.

Requiring Payment Before Shipping

To mitigate the risk of R08 returns, consider implementing a policy that requires customers to pay for items before shipping. By keeping records of these payments, you can ensure that the customer’s bank has authorized the transaction, further reducing the chances of an R08 return.

Ensuring Accurate and Complete Information on Checks and Documents

Ensuring that all the information on checks and documents is accurate and complete is another effective way to prevent R08 returns. This includes double-checking the bank routing number and account number, and ensuring that all necessary documents have been accurately filled out and signed.

At NachaTech, we understand that preventing R08 returns is not just about reducing costs but also about maintaining good customer relationships. Our ACH file editing and validation tool can help you streamline your financial transactions and reduce the occurrence of R08 returns. By implementing these preventive measures, you can focus more on growing your business and less on managing returns.

The Role of NachaTech in Resolving R08 Return Code Issues

Dealing with R08 return code issues can be a complex task. However, we at NachaTech have designed a robust software solution that assists financial institutions to efficiently manage these issues, thereby reducing disruptions and maintaining smooth financial transactions.

How NachaTech Helps Financial Institutions Edit and Validate NACHA Files

NachaTech provides a state-of-the-art tool that allows you to open, edit, and validate ACH files swiftly and accurately. Our unique selling point is the raw line editing feature that enables businesses to make necessary changes adhering to NACHA standards. This feature gives you the flexibility to go beyond the usual constraints, making it simpler to handle errors in NACHA files.

Additionally, our software is equipped with an embedded ABA database. This feature facilitates rapid validation of ABA (American Bankers Association) numbers, an integral element of ACH transactions. Incorrect ABA numbers can lead to failed transactions and eventually R08 return codes. With our rapid validation, you can ensure your ACH files contain valid ABA numbers, thereby reducing the risk of ACH payment rejections.

The Benefits of Using NachaTech to Eliminate ACH Payment Rejections

Investing in NachaTech’s software solution brings significant benefits to your financial institution.

Firstly, our tool is designed to handle major errors head-on, preventing potential ACH payment rejections. This proactive approach to error handling helps keep your business transactions flowing smoothly, minimizing disruptions and unnecessary costs.

Secondly, our software makes it easier to identify and rectify errors. By providing a swift and accurate validation process, we help you reduce the occurrence of R08 return codes, enhancing your efficiency in ACH transactions.

Lastly, we understand the importance of preventing errors before they occur. That’s why we offer preventive measures like regular risk assessments and documented policies and procedures for reviewing and processing ACH files. These measures help you minimize the risk of ACH payment rejections and ensure successful transactions.

In conclusion, NachaTech’s capabilities, from handling major errors to providing raw line editing and fast ABA numbers validation, make it an invaluable ally in managing the R08 return code issues. We’re not just a tool, we’re a partner in your journey towards streamlined and error-free ACH processing.

Conclusion: The Importance of Understanding and Addressing the R08 Return Code

The R08 return code, or payment stoppage, is a significant issue within the Automated Clearing House (ACH) network. This code often signifies a problem with the payer’s account, leading to payment delays and potential financial losses. As such, understanding the ins and outs of the R08 return code is critical for financial institutions and businesses relying on ACH transactions.

Failure to properly address and resolve the R08 return code can disrupt the payment process, affect customer satisfaction, and even strain relationships with clients. This is why financial institutions must be proactive in investigating, resolving, and preventing issues relating to the R08 return code.

At NachaTech, we understand the importance of this. We provide tools to help your organization open and edit ACH files with major errors, allowing you to rectify these issues easily. Our fast validation of ABA numbers ensures that you can validate large ACH files in seconds, a task that other tools might take minutes to complete.

With the correct understanding and utilization of ACH transaction and service class codes, we can assist you in navigating the complex landscape of ACH transactions. Our goal is to make ACH processing simpler and more efficient, minimizing the occurrence of issues like the R08 return code.

In the vast labyrinth of ACH transactions, the R08 return code is one thread that can guide you towards successful and error-free financial transactions. By addressing this issue promptly and effectively, you can ensure a smooth transaction process, maintain customer satisfaction, and ultimately, boost your bottom line.

For further insights into ACH transaction codes, we recommend reading our detailed guide on Editing and Validating ACH files. You can also read our post on the common reasons for ACH payment rejections and how to fix them.

With NachaTech, navigating the complex world of ACH transactions becomes simpler and more efficient. Let us be your proactive solution in ensuring smooth, successful, and error-free ACH transactions.